Related: The Chicago Sun-Times, in its partnership with WBEZ, is doing stellar work right now.

Including this piece about the downstream effects of ICE enforcement on stuff like apartment rents and maintenance

chicago.suntimes.com/real-estate/...
The fear among residents and workers, both documented and undocumented, is palpable, he said. Residents are scared to open their doors for maintenance workers, and it has become harder to schedule repairs with his work force.
Other property managers and owners said workers are not showing up at job sites - frightened by ICE — and it's causing delays on building repairs and maintenance. Some residents are not able to pay rent on time as they are holed up at home, too afraid to go to work with federal agents popping up throughout the city.
This adds to the already rising business costs for building owners and managers, some who say they are eating the increased expenses connected to ICE raids. But if the enforcement activity continues into the busy spring moving season, property managers and owners like Warren said they may have to increase rents to recoup some of their costs.
